During a long time i had lag/frozen screen problems on some tracks (Long Beach 2007,Sebring Int. Raceway,Suzuka 2012,...) or with some mod (DTM) and it was very annoying because This had a big impact on my competitiveness during race.
I know it wasn't a problem with my pc as it is powerful one but problems with the settings of GTR2 and elsewhere.
Finally one day i found the solutions and from this moment i didn't have any frozen screen/lags problems.
I write this post today to share my experience and help anyone who have this problem (Ogurchik on the Nos).
There is 2 fix to do to solve this issue (actually possibly 3 fix).
1st Fix (The easiest)
Run GTR2, Options / Advanced / LEVEL OF DETAIL BIAS Put it to 75%.
You can also change it manually without going InGame by changing your *.PLR (for example : C:\GTR2\UserData\YourNickname\YourNickname.PLR)
LOD Multiplier Multiplier="0.75000"
By Default the value is "1.00000"
I did not really see changes on graphics while racing but probably it has.
2nd Fix (a little bit more complicated)
In GTR2 (also GTLegends) there is a problem with the antialiasing/anisotropic settings as they are basic/outdated and doesn't manage advanced AA/AF that you have got with recent nvidia/AMD panel.
(Source :
https://www.overtake.gg/threads/how-to-install-
gtr2-and-png3-in-2019.173928/ ).
In your GTR2config.EXE (choose 32bits resolution, dx9) but Do NOT choose AA/AF (level 1/2/...).
If you have a Radeon Graphic card you will have to install RadeonMod (i don't have one Radeon graphic card so i can't tell how to replace/override application setting for AA on RadeonMod)
If you have an Nvidia Graphic Card You will have to install Nvidia Profile Inspector
https://github.com/Orbmu2k/nvidiaProfileInspector/
releases
Run nvidiaProfileInspector.exe (with Administrator rights "it is always better" )
Make a save of your original GTR2 nvidia profile : "export current profile only" / "GTR 2.nip" choose a place on your HDD / Save.
In Profiles (Top Left), Type "GTR" and choose GTR2
1 - Compatibility
Antialiasing - Compatibility (DX9) - "change to" Diablo III (0x004412C1)
2 - Sync and Refresh
(optionnal) Frame Rate Limiter V3 - "my config" 150 FPS (Only if you have lots FPS while you play example more than 300 FPS) or leave it "Off"
3 - Antialiasing
Antialiasing (MSAA) - Mode - "change to" Override any application setting
Antialisaing (MSAA) - Setting - Application-controlled / Off ( you can improve your graphics by changing this to 8x or 16x or else but you can also have FrozenScreen/lag again so better to keep it to "Off" )
4 - Texture Filtering
Anisotropic Filtering - Mode - "change to" User-defined / Off
(optionnal) Texture Filtering - Negative LOD bias - "Allow"
At the top Right click on "Apply Changes"
3rd Fix (maybe not necessary but improve a lot the performance of GTR2)
GTR2 use only 1 core of your CPU while you play but you can install a software (free) to make GTR2 use ALL your cores of your CPU.
Download and install "Process Lasso"
https://bitsum.com/get-lasso-pro/?inproduct
Run ProcessLassoLauncher.exe (with Administrator rights "it is always better" )
Everytime you run Process Lasso you will have a commercial window and have to wait to open the software but in fact you just need to click on "buy now" and then to close the internet window.
That's all you have to do to open quickly Process Lasso without buying it and you could also updated it without buying it. if you want to buy it of course you can.
In Process Lasso, Choose "Parameters", "CPU", "CPU Affinity"
Processus Match you type "gtr2.exe" without "
Affinity CPU , click on Select, then click on ALL (select all your cpu), then click on "OK"
For my part i have chosen all my 15 CPU cores but of course you can decide how many to choose. I never had any problems even if i have chosen all my 15 CPU cores.
Normally you will see in the window "gtr2.exe / 0-15" (if you have chosen 15 CPU cores)
That's all for Process Lasso.
Of Course before launching GTR2 you will have to open Process Lasso and thanks to this software GTR2 will use all your cpu cores while playing and it will really improve the performance of the game and probably avoid some issues or crash.
That's All !
I must say i play GTR2 on 3 screens with a resolution of 11520X2160
In GTR2 i have all my video options on Maximum (except "Shadow - High" ), 30 Vehicules Visibles.
I use the XD with the track map while racing.
Since i made theses fixes i never had again LAG/Frozen screen with any mods or on any tracks.
I can also say i didn't have any "crash game" in 2 years of racing on Kolschbierbude (except 1 on Zandvoort 2020 with Porsche mod which make me think it is a bug in the track)
I hope this post could help.